Description

ChEBI: An azabicycloalkane that is 1,5-dimethyl-3-azabicyclo[3.1.0]hexane-2,4-dione in which the amino hydrogen is replaced by a 3,5-dichlorophenyl group. A fungicide widely used in horticulture as a seed dressing, pre-harvest spray or post-harvest dip for the co trol of various diseases.

Procymidone Use and Manufacturing

Methods of Manufacturing

The first preparation method is prepared from methyl α-chloropropionate, α-methyl methacrylate and 3, 5-dichloroaniline as raw materials. First, α-chloropropionic acid methyl ester and α-methyl methacrylate are reacted to prepare 1, 2-dimethylcyclopropane-1, 2-dicarboxylic acid methyl ester, and then hydrolyzed to obtain 1, 2-dimethyl Cyclopropane-1, 2-dicarboxylic acid. The above product is reacted with 3, 5-dichloroaniline to synthesize procymidone. Preparation method: Di-α-methacrylic acid ethyl ester is reacted with α-chloropropionic acid ethyl ester, potassium butoxide and sodium hydroxide, and acetic anhydride to prepare 1, 2-dimethylcyclopropane-1, 2-di Carboxylic anhydride. Add benzene solution of 3, 5-dichloroaniline dropwise, precipitate the intermediate, stir for 30 min after dropping, remove benzene under reduced pressure, add acetic anhydride and anhydrous sodium acetate to the residue, heat at 100℃ for 30-60 min, remove Remove acetic acid and excess acetic anhydride, wash with dilute sodium hydroxide and water, and dry to obtain a putrefaction agent. mp165~167℃.
